I tend to travel within about 100 miles of home, I don't go North of the Humber, or much South of the M25, but I would go anywhere if there were enough animals to make it worth it - I go to Dorset once a month.
The sheep scanner ought to do goats, but sometimes they can't be bothered to stop rushing and do a few. I can understand that, the "big boys" will be doing 60,000 sheep in the season, I only do about 5,000, really I'm a cow scanner who does a few sheep, and I'm so bloody lazy that I quite like doing half a dozen and then going home
I've got a lot of little jobs that the big boys don't want, I think somebody with 50 sheep is just as important as somebody with 500. ( like my monika)
